Causes of rubber sheet aging
The rubber sheets in the warehouse lie quietly, yet they are silently undergoing aging. Have you ever wondered why they age even when not in use?
Chemical reactions
The main component of rubber sheets is polymer. These polymers may chemically react with the oxygen in the air in the storage environment. This reaction is called oxidation, which usually leads to a decline in material performance. For example, in a closed, humid warehouse, the aging speed of rubber sheets may be much faster than in a dry, well-ventilated environment.
The effects of ultraviolet rays
- Even inside the warehouse, ultraviolet rays can penetrate through the windows.
- If the rubber sheets are exposed to direct sunlight, the aging process will accelerate.
This situation is especially true in areas that are not properly shielded, where the surface of the rubber sheets may develop cracks, and in severe cases, even lead to material breakage.
Temperature Changes
Temperature fluctuations are another factor that causes rubber sheet aging. Under high-temperature conditions, the molecular chains of rubber may break, affecting its elasticity and strength. In low-temperature conditions, rubber sheets may become hard and brittle.
Imagine a warehouse where the temperature soars to 40°C in summer and drops to -10°C in winter; the fate of the rubber sheets is easy to imagine.
Storage methods
- Improper stacking: If rubber sheets are stacked improperly, gravity will cause the material at the bottom to gradually deform.
- Water accumulation: If the warehouse is poorly managed and the ground is damp, moisture will seep into the rubber sheets, further accelerating their deterioration.
